Romeo Lavia's preference is to join Chelsea despite Liverpool agreeing a £60m deal for the Southampton midfielder.

 Romeo Lavia is being chased by Liverpool and Chelsea; Reds struck a deal thought to be worth £60m but Blues were close to an agreement with Southampton at end of last week; Lavia wants to join Chelsea with the Blues already beating Liverpool to signing of Moises Caicedo from Brighton Liverpool have already missed out on Moises Caicedo to Chelsea after the Brighton midfielder moved to Stamford Bridge for a British record £115m. Liverpool had a £111m offer accepted by Brighton only for the 21-year-old to inform them he only intended to join Chelsea. Southampton had been holding firm on their £50m valuation of 19-year-old Lavia. Chelsea had made an offer of £48m last week, while Liverpool had seen three previous offers turned down this summer
